The Landscape of Norwegian Driving Regulations
Norway's Public Roads Administration (Statens vegvesen) manages all licensing, screening, and automobile guidelines. The country boasts some of the best roads on the planet, a statistic preserved by imposing rigorous driving requirements, comprehensive necessary training, and zero-tolerance policies relating to traffic offenses.
Before taking a look at faster ways or alternative services, it is crucial to comprehend what the standard, legal acquisition procedure requires.
Standard Requirements for a Norwegian Driving License
To receive a standard Class B (automobile) license in Norway, candidates need to meet the following baseline requirements:
- Age Requirement: Must be at least 18 years of ages (though traffic training can start at 16).
- Residency: Must be a registered local in Norway with a legitimate D-number or nationwide identity number (fødselsnummer).
- Health Requirements: Must pass a medical evaluation, particularly concerning vision and any conditions that might impact driving ability.
- First-Aid Course: Completion of a necessary first-aid training course.
- Darkness Driving Demonstration (Mørkekjøring): A useful course demonstrating driving in the dark.

Step-by-Step Guide to Legal Acquisition
For anyone dedicated to protecting their driving benefits the right method, following a structured plan ensures success.
- Step 1: Obtain a Learner's PermitApply online by means of the Statens vegvesen website and complete the obligatory Traffic Basic Course (Trafikalt grunnkurs).
- Step 2: Choose a Certified Traffic SchoolEnlist in lessons with an authorized trainer to master Norwegian road rules, roundabouts, and winter season driving techniques.
- Action 3: Pass the Theory Test (Teoritentamen)Research study the main Norwegian traffic manual and pass the computerized multiple-choice test at a traffic station.
- Step 4: Complete Mandatory Safety Training
- Trinn 3 (Vurderingstime): Intermediate evaluation.
- Trinn 4 (Siste førerforberedelse): Safety courses on slippery tracks (glattkjøring) and long-distance driving.
- Step 5: Pass the Practical Driving TestDemonstrate safe, independent driving capability to an official sensor from Statens vegvesen.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I drive in Norway with a foreign license?
Yes. If you hold a valid driving license from an EU/EEA country, you can drive in Norway till your license ends. If your license is from outside the EU/EEA, you can generally use it for approximately 3 months after using up residency, after which you should exchange or convert it.
2. Is it possible to bypass the driving test in Norway?
Typically, no. Bypassing the practical driving test is just possible if you are exchanging a license from an EU/EEA nation or a particular country with a mutual contract with Norway. All other applicants must pass the tests.
3. What happens if I am caught utilizing a fake driving license?
Using a created or illegally acquired driving license is a serious crime in Norway. It leads to instant confiscation, criminal charges, heavy fines, and billig norsk føRerkort a long-term restriction from requesting a legal license.
4. How much does a basic Norwegian driving license expense?
Due to high obligatory lesson requirements, the cost of getting a license lawfully through a traffic school normally varies from 25,000 to 45,000 NOK (approx. ₤ 2,400-- ₤ 4,300 GBP), depending on the number of lessons an individual needs.
